Phase I/II Trail Evaluating Carbon Ion Radiotherapy (3 GyE Per Fraction) for Salvaging Treatment of Locally Recurrent Nasopharyngeal Carcinoma

详细描述

The purpose of this study is to determine the maximal tolerated dose (MTD) of re-irradiation using carbon ion radiotherapy (CIRT) with the fraction size of 3 GyE in the treatment of locally recurrent nasopharyngeal cancer (NPC) and to evaluate the efficacy of such treatment at the MTD. Participants will be treated with CIRT with escalating dose starting from 54GyE (3GyE/daily fraction) to potentially 63GyE (3GyE/daily fraction) to evaluate the maximal tolerated dose (MTD) in terms of acute and subacute toxicity observed during and within 4 months after the completion of CIRT. The TITE-CRM method is used for the phase I dose escalating part of the trial and approximately 25 patients will be accrued. Once the MTD for locally recurrent NPC is determined, the MTD will be used as the recommended dose to patients fulfilling the inclusion criteria in the Phase II part of the trial. The Phase II part of the trial will be a single stage single arm study.

入选标准

  • Completed a definitive course of intensity-modulated photon radiation therapy (IMXT) to a total dose of ≥ 66 Gy
  • Recurrence diagnosed more than 12 months after the initial course of IMXT
  • Age ≥ 18 and < 70 years of age
  • Karnofsky Performance Score ≥70
  • Willing to accept adequate contraception for women with childbearing potential
  • Ability to understand character and individual consequences of the clinical trial
  • Willing to sign the written informed consent; Informed consent must be signed before the enrollment in the trial

排除标准

  • Presence of distant metastasis
  • Technology used other than IMXT (including brachytherapy following IMXT) for the treatment of initial diagnosis of NPC
  • Pregnant or lactating women
  • Patients who have not yet recovered from acute toxicities of prior therapies
  • A diagnosis of malignancy other than carcinoma in situ of the cervix, basal cell carcinoma and squamous cell carcinoma of the skin within the past 5 years

结局指标

主要结局

Number of participants with treatment-related adverse events as assessed by CTCAE v4.0 (phase 1)

时间窗: Within 4 months after the completion of treatment

The primary objective of phase 1 is to identify the maximum tolerated dose which is defined as the highest dose associated with a probability of dose limiting toxicity \<=25%.

Phase 2: Overall survival (OS)

时间窗: 2 years

Overall survival (OS) was defined as the time frame from enrollment to the date of death from any cause.

次要结局

  • Phase 2: Progression-free survival(2 years)
